Tickets for the Addicks' Cup Final clash against Millwall will go on restricted sale to supporters with a purchase history* on Friday, August 8th at 11am.
Nathan Jones' side host the Lions in their cup final game at The Valley on Saturday, September 13th (KO 12.30pm BST) and with a high demand for tickets expected (what with it being our cup final), season-ticket holders will be given the opportunity to purchase up to two tickets for the cup final on Wednesday, August 6th from 11am.
The fixture has been designated as a Charlton Cup Final with adult ticket prices starting at £30.
*Supporters will need to have a purchase history on the club's ticketing system as of 11am on Friday, August 1st to be able to purchase tickets.
A number of home tickets for the cup final against Millwall will be reserved for Valley Gold members and will be available to purchase from 11am on Friday, August 8th.
